The Usual Suspects: Why Your Go-To Solutions Are a Risky Bet

When faced with a high-stakes call, the typical solutions are risky compromises. While the local café seems economical and a coworking space appears professional, a closer look reveals their unreliability for anything that truly matters. Silence and confidentiality have a price, but the cost of a failed meeting is far greater.

  • Your Home Office: Predictably unpredictable. You might have a quiet morning, or you might have a symphony of neighbors' DIY projects, barking dogs, and unexpected deliveries. Verdict: High risk, zero guarantees.
  • The Bustling Café: A classic choice for a change of scenery, but a disaster for professional calls. Background noise is unprofessional, the Wi-Fi is often slow and unsecured, and privacy is non-existent. Verdict: Unprofessional and insecure.
  • The Coworking Space: A step up, offering better Wi-Fi and a work-oriented atmosphere. However, most offer open-plan desks or 'phone booths' that are rarely truly soundproof. For a truly sensitive conversation, you're still at the mercy of your surroundings. The difference between this and true privacy is stark, as detailed in this ultimate test between coworking noise and hotel silence. Verdict: Better, but not confidential.

Your Game Plan for a Flawless Video Conference

A perfect video conference in an exceptional setting doesn't happen by chance; it's planned. With a few simple steps, you can turn a simple booking into a strategic advantage.

  1. Anticipate and Book: Use Siestify to reserve your 3, 4, or 6-hour slot at the Hôtel Burdigala. The process is quick, flexible, and often doesn't require a credit card upfront.
  2. Arrive and Set Up: Get there 15-20 minutes early. This gives you time to connect to the professional-grade Wi-Fi, test your audio and lighting, and settle in without rushing.
  3. Fuel Your Focus: Use the room service to order a coffee or lunch. This eliminates any logistical stress, allowing you to approach your call feeling refreshed and prepared.
  4. Execute with Confidence: With all external distractions eliminated, you can be 100% focused on your audience and your message.
